4ZUA
Crystal structure of the ExsA regulatory domain
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| NSLS BEAMLINE X29A |
| Synchrotron site | NSLS |
| Beamline | X29A |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2012-05-15 |
| Detector | ADSC QUANTUM 315 |
| Wavelength(s) | 1.075 |
| Spacegroup name | P 43 21 2 |
| Unit cell lengths | 69.949, 69.949, 191.802 |
| Unit cell angles | 90.00, 90.00, 90.00 |
